AWS, GCP, Python Certified | Ansible | Docker | Kubernetes | Linux | DB
Skilled DevOps engineer with AWS and Microsoft Python certified having 6+ years of experience in implementing CI-CD pipeline and scripting. As DevOps engineer, set up and managed AWS services, Docker, Kubernetes Cluster, Linux Administration, automate deployment process using Jenkins, Bamboo, GIT, Bit bucket, Ansible, Apache, WebSphere, Nginx for around 50+ Java, Dot Net, Spring Boot, Angular applications in more than 100+ deployment servers. Worked closely with clients to slash release time and automate the process using a single commit. Monitored various deployment servers with the help of Grafana and Prometheus.
DevOps Services:
Repository Management:
Git: Branching Strategy, Webhooks for auto-deployment: Jenkins, Bamboo, CodeBuild/CodePipeline
Bitbucket: Bitbucket Pipeline
Gitlab: Gitlab Yaml Pipeline
CI-CD Planning:
Jenkins: CICD: Build and Deployment, Groovy Pipeline, Multi branch Pipeline, Unit Testing, Selenium, Load Testing, Docker/Kubernetes Containers Deployment, Administration, AWS Deployment to ECR, ECS, ELasticbeanstak, EC2
Bamboo: CICD Jobs and Plan Setup
Deployment and Cluster Management:
Docker: Scripting Dockerfile, Running containers, Docker Swarm cluster management, Networking troubleshooting, Volumes and Backup
Kubernetes: Kubeadm and Kubectl cluster management, Scripting YAML for pods, services, deployments, replicas, secrets, cluster-roles, Installation of the cluster with integration to Jenkins
Monitoring:
Prometheus: Configuring targets from Kubernetes, Jenkins and other tools for monitoring
Grafana: Scripting YAML to get logs from Prometheus
Server Management:
Nginx: reverse proxy, virtual host, path-based routing
Apache
Scripting
Terraform: AWS Infrastructure setup
Cloud formation: Infra Setup with automating deployments
Ansible: Playbooks and scripts, with roles to automate server configuration deployments
Groovy: Jenkins pipeline
python: Lambda function with Boto3 library
shell